Axcis Education is recruiting a resilient and proactive Inclusion Teacher to support pupils with additional needs and challenging behaviour within a supportive primary school in Rugby. This is a temporary‑to‑permanent opportunity starting in September, ideal for someone looking to secure a long‑term teaching position within an inclusive and nurturing school environment.

Responsibilities

  • Lead targeted support for pupils with SEND, including those with challenging behaviour
  • Deliver adapted lessons and interventions on a 1:1 and small group basis
  • Implement behaviour plans and positive reinforcement strategies
  • Support pupils with ASD, ADHD and SEMH needs
  • Work closely with the SENCO and wider staff team to plan and differentiate learning
  • Promote emotional regulation, engagement, and social development
  • Create and maintain a safe, structured, and inclusive learning environment

About You

  •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) or experience teaching within SEND/inclusion settings
  • Strong experience supporting pupils with SEMH and challenging behaviour
  • Calm, consistent, and confident approach to behaviour management
  • Ability to adapt teaching to meet a range of additional needs
  • A committed team player with excellent communication skills
  • Passionate about inclusive education and making a lasting impact
